How to Make Chicken in Garlic Sauce Now that you have your ingredients ready, it’s time to bring this Chicken in Garlic Sauce to life! Follow these simple steps, and you’ll have a delicious meal on the table in no time. Step 1: Marinate the Chicken Start by placing the bite-sized chicken pieces in a bowl. Add soy sauce and cornstarch, then mix everything well. This marinade not only flavors the chicken but also helps create a nice coating. Let it sit for at least 15 minutes. If you have time, marinating longer will deepen the flavor. Step 2: Cook the Chicken Heat vegetable oil in a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at. Once the oil is hot, add the marinated chicken. Cook it for about 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until it’s browned and cooked through. Remove the chicken from the skillet and set it aside. This step is crucial for achieving that perfect texture. Step 3: Sauté Garlic and Ginger In the same skillet, toss in the minced garlic and ginger. Stir-fry them for about 30 seconds until they become fragrant. The aroma will fill your kitchen, making it hard to resist! Be careful not to burn them, as burnt garlic can turn bitter. Step 4: Create the Sauce Now, it’s time to build the sauce. Add chicken broth, rice vinegar, sugar, and sesame oil to the skillet. If you like a bit of heat, sprinkle in some crushed red pepper flakes. Stir everything well to combine. This sauce is where the magic happens, bringing all those flavors together. Step 5: Combine Chicken and Vegetables Return the cooked chicken to the skillet. Add the sliced bell peppers and broccoli florets. Stir-fry everything together for another 3-5 minutes. You want the vegetables to be tender-crisp, adding both color and nutrition to your dish. The vibrant hues will make your meal visually appealing! Step 6: Serve and Garnish Once everything is cooked to perfection, it’s time to serve! Spoon the Chicken in Garlic Sauce over a bed of cooked rice. Garnish with chopped green onions for a fresh touch. Enjoy the delightful flavors and watch your family or friends dig in! Tips for Success Always use fresh garlic and ginger for the best flavor. Don’t overcrowd the pan when cooking the chicken; it helps achieve that perfect sear. Feel free to customize the veggies based on what you have on hand. For a thicker sauce, mix a bit more cornstarch with water and add it at the end. Let the dish sit for a minute before serving to allow flavors to meld. Variations of Chicken in Garlic Sauce Tofu Substitute: Swap out chicken for firm tofu for a vegetarian option. Just press the tofu to remove excess moisture before marinating. Shrimp Delight: Use shrimp instead of chicken for a seafood twist. Cook the shrimp until they turn pink and opaque. Veggie-Loaded: Add more vegetables like snap peas, carrots, or mushrooms for a colorful and nutritious boost. Spicy Garlic Chicken: Increase the crushed red pepper flakes or add a splash of sriracha for a fiery kick. Gluten-Free Option: Ensure the soy sauce is gluten-free or use tamari for a similar flavor without the gluten. Author: Isabella Prep Time: 15 minutes Cook Time: 15 minutes Total Time: 30 minutes Yield: 4 servings 1x Category: Main Dish Method: Stir-fry Cuisine: Asian Diet: Gluten Free Ingredients Scale 1x2x3x 2 pounds bo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into bite-sized pieces 1/4 cup soy sauce 2 tablespoons cornstarch 2 tablespoons vegetable oil 6 cloves garlic, minced 1 tablespoon fresh ginger, minced 1/4 cup chicken broth 1 tablespoon rice vinegar 1 tablespoon sugar 1 teaspoon sesame oil 1/2 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es (optional) 1 cup bell peppers, sliced (any color) 1 cup broccoli florets 2 green onions, chopped (for garnish) Cooked rice, for serving Cook Mode Prevent your screen from going dark Instructions In a bowl, combine the chicken pieces with soy sauce and cornstarch. Mix well and let marinate for at least 15 minutes. Heat vegetable oil in a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at. Add the marinated chicken and cook until browned and cooked through, about 5-7 minutes. Remove the chicken from the skillet and set aside. In the same skillet, add minced garlic and ginger. Stir-fry for about 30 seconds until fragrant. Add chicken broth, rice vinegar, sugar, sesame oil, and crushed red pepper flakes (if using) to the skillet. Stir well to combine. Return the cooked chicken to the skillet and add the sliced bell peppers and broccoli florets. Stir-fry for another 3-5 minutes until the vegetables are tender-crisp. Serve hot over cooked rice and garnish with chopped green onions. Notes For a spicier kick, add more crushed red pepper flakes or a dash of hot sauce. You can also substitute the chicken with tofu or shrimp for a different protein option. If you prefer a thicker sauce, mix an additional teaspoon of cornstarch with a tablespoon of water and stir it into the sauce during the last minute of cooking.
